• home
  • contact
  • menu
  • register

  • Yorkville

    Paris, New York, and London are around the corner, within easy walking distance from 181 Davenport. Yorkville is where the world's leading designers locate their shops in Toronto. The landscape architecture of its central urban park is widely acclaimed for its innovative and pleasing environment. Relax with a coffee before heading off to a gallery or to shop for the latest fashions. Yorkville is Toronto's intimate village of design, art and entertainment where the business and creative classes come to find the best the city has to offer.

    Unfortunately your browser does not support Flash Player version 10. Without Flash you will be unable to experience our site as it was meant to be seen.

    Please click here to download the latest version of Flash.